The Global Certificate Course in Inclusive Urban Resilience equips participants with the knowledge and skills to address the complex challenges faced by cities worldwide. This program focuses on building resilient and equitable urban environments, emphasizing sustainable development and disaster risk reduction strategies.
Learning outcomes include a deep understanding of resilience frameworks, participatory planning methodologies, and the integration of social equity into urban development projects. Participants will be able to assess urban vulnerabilities, design inclusive resilience strategies, and advocate for policy changes promoting sustainable urban development. The curriculum also covers climate change adaptation and mitigation within an urban context.
